Plastic bags can be found almost everywhere around us. (30)According to. the American Plastics Council, 80 percent of groceries are packed in plastic bags. The numbers are absolutely surprising. It is estimated that consumers use between 500 billion and one trillion plastic bags per year all over the world. Plastic bags can be found in landfills, stuck on trees, and floating in the ocean.
Some experts say that plastic bags may harm the environment. It may take hundreds of years for plastic bags to break down. As they break down, they will release poisonous materials into the water and the soil. (31)Plastic bags in the ocean can choke wildlife. Endangered sea turtles eat the bags and often choke on them—probably because the bags look like its favorite food. In fact, floating plastic bags have been spotted from as far north as the Arctic Ocean to as far south as the southern end of South America. One expert even gives a prediction that within ten years, plastic bags will wash up in Antarctica!
While some experts have argued for placing a heavy tax on plastic bags, others worry that the tax would cause people who make plastic hags to lose jobs. Some people also worry that making plastic bags more expensive would increase landfill waste because stores would start using paper bags again. Another possible solution would be to use plastic bags that can be easily broken down, a technology that has recently improved. (32)Perhaps the simplest solution for now, however, is to pack groceries in reusable bags.
